Thousands of Australians have started a campaign to change the way their national television station broadcasts the Olympics.
They say that so far Channel 9 has shown nothing but Team Australia's successes and not much of anything else.
John Thompson-Mills, a journalist for ABC News in Adelaide, told 5 liveBreakfast about the various online petitions.
